An introductory collection of reflections on basic Buddhist philosophy. Major principles include: the nature of the mind, the thoughts it produces, the importance of breath, methods for controlling & strengthening the mind, how to rest the mind to restore it, how to develop focus & how to use it to produce mental authority. The book is divided into 11 sections with 52 concise pieces - all written simply & clearly, in a way that is thoughtful & explanatory & heavy on analogy & rhyme.
Individual pieces include: basic principles of the mind; things that grow in the fertile fields of the mind; understanding & controlling breath; the preciousness of thought; how the mind is like a horse - & a potting wheel; the sediment at the depths of the mind; the essence, paradox & flow of focus; developing mental authority & using it as a torch to explore; how to work happiness like a muscle & make your mind stronger; the core of inner peace & more.
Quotes from: the Buddha, Thich Nhat Hanh, Hluang Pau Pramote Pamojjo, Steve Jobs, H. W. Longfellow & Lee Xiaolong. Includes photos of Buddha statues from temples in Bangkok's Thonburi district - at Wat Arun, Wat Prayura Wongsawas, Wat Hong Rattanaram, Wat Rakhang, Wat Molio Kayaram Raja Worawiharn, Wat Taung Nopakuhn, Wat Anongkaram & Wat Phitchaya Yatikaram.
